分布式账本系统(Distributed Ledger Technology,简称DLT)是一种基于区块链的去中心化账本技术。它通过将数据分散存储在多个节点上,实现了数据的透明性、安全性和可追溯性。以下是分布式账本系统采取的一些原则:
1. 去中心化:分布式账本系统的核心特征是去中心化,即没有单一的中心服务器或数据库来控制和管理整个系统。每个参与者都有权参与系统的运行和维护,从而降低了单点故障的风险。
2. 透明性:分布式账本系统的数据是公开透明的,任何人都可以查看和验证系统中的交易记录。这种透明性有助于提高信任度,减少欺诈行为。
3. 安全性:分布式账本系统采用加密技术保护数据的安全性。每个节点都需要使用私钥进行签名和验证交易,确保只有授权的用户才能访问和修改数据。此外,分布式账本系统还采用了共识机制来防止恶意攻击和篡改数据。
4. 可追溯性:分布式账本系统的数据是不可篡改的,一旦数据被写入系统,就无法被删除或修改。这使得数据具有可追溯性,有助于解决纠纷和追踪问题。
5. 可扩展性:分布式账本系统可以通过增加新的节点来扩展系统的容量。随着节点数量的增加,系统的处理能力和存储能力也会相应提高,满足不断增长的数据需求。
6. 智能合约:分布式账本系统支持智能合约,这是一种自动执行的程序,可以根据预定的规则和条件执行交易。智能合约可以提高交易的效率和安全性,降低人工干预的需求。
7. 跨链通信:分布式账本系统可以实现不同区块链之间的通信,实现跨链资产转移和价值交换。这有助于促进不同区块链生态系统之间的互操作性和协同发展。
8. 隐私保护:分布式账本系统可以提供一定程度的隐私保护,用户可以选择不公开自己的交易信息,从而保护自己的隐私。
9. 共识机制:分布式账本系统采用共识机制来决定哪些交易将被添加到区块链中。不同的共识机制有不同的优缺点,如工作量证明(Proof of Work, PoW)、权益证明(Proof of Stake, PoS)等。选择合适的共识机制对于保证系统的稳定性和性能至关重要。
10. 可编程性:分布式账本系统允许开发者为系统编写自定义的智能合约,以满足特定业务场景的需求。这使得DLT系统具有很高的灵活性和可定制性。
总之,分布式账本系统遵循一系列原则,包括去中心化、透明性、安全性、可追溯性、可扩展性、智能合约、跨链通信、隐私保护、共识机制和可编程性。这些原则共同构成了分布式账本系统的基础,使其在金融、供应链、医疗等多个领域具有广泛的应用前景。